2013 IDR to AOA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2013

During 2013, the IDR to AOA ex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on March 24, valuing the pair at 0.0100.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 27, dropping to 0.0080.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0020 AOA.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0099 to the December average rate of 0.0081, the exchange rate registered a net change of -18.49%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2013 high of 0.0100 was down 6.48% compared to the 2012 peak of 0.0107,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.0100 0.0099 0.0099
February 0.0100 0.0099 0.0099
March 0.0100 0.0099 0.0099
April 0.0099 0.0098 0.0099
May 0.0099 0.0098 0.0099
June 0.0099 0.0097 0.0098
July 0.0097 0.0093 0.0096
August 0.0094 0.0087 0.0091
September 0.0088 0.0084 0.0086
October 0.0089 0.0085 0.0086
November 0.0086 0.0082 0.0084
December 0.0083 0.0080 0.0081
